F1, Charles Leclerc returns to win by force in Austria

Fifth career win for the Ferrarista
In the home of Red Bull, Charles Leclerc returned to victory. Third win of the season, the fifth of his career, for the Ferrarista in the Austrian GP, where he also had to deal with throttle problems in the finale.
A strong race by the Monegasque always on the attack on Max Verstappen, who started ahead of everyone. Ferrari also strong in strategies, with Leclerc thus beating the Red Bull Dutchman putting him now at -38 in the championship. New podium for Lewis Hamilton, third in the Mercedes.
Retired Carlos Sainz with engine knock with a few laps to go, when Ferrari could have made at least a double podium. Zero also for Sergio Perez’s other Red Bull, out early in the race. Fourth George Russell in the other Mercedes, fifth Esteban Ocon in Alpine and sixth a great Mick Schumacher in Haas.
